One of the distributor screws hole is broken on a 5.0 mecruicser MPI. I can't believe the top of the distributor is plastic. I read that there is a repair kit for $25 but don't have any details.
Has anyone heard off the repair? Any details would be great.

Yep, they are made out of plastic. I did a repair by removing the remnents and bolting on a piece of starboard , shaping to fit and drilled and tapped a new hole

Found a solution made for this issue. Not crazy about sheet metal screws. I'll try tapping out plate and using machine screws.

Dorman 90449 Distribution Repair Plate​
